In bronze, finely cut dies for various components of the medal, engraver marked "Paquet F." on the obverse, engraved "The Congress to George F. Thompson Co. K. 27th. Me. Vol", measuring 53 mm (w) x 68. 8 mm (h) inclusive of its eagle above crossed cannons and cannonballs suspension, variation of the American flag in the original ribbon, bronze pinback hanger with U. S. shield, near mint. Footnote: The 27th Maine Volunteer Infantry Regiment
